It is wise to provide the tenant with an itemized list of the items comprised in the apartment rental to protect your investment when renting a furnished flat. Be quite particular; list the number of plates, bowls, and cups, for example, and describe things as accurately as possible. List the replacement cost of each thing if it is damaged beyond ordinary wear and tear, or if the renter takes the piece with him when he moves out. Signal if the renter will must pay you directly for the items, or if the replacement cost will be required out of the security deposit. Have the tenant sign a copy of this inventory so there are not any surprises when the lease comes to a finish.

If you rent a house or flat that is furnished, whether it contains merely some basic furniture or is fully furnished with furniture, linens, electronic equipment, and accessories, you can charge renters higher rent. You will need to replace those items if they can be damaged or ruined, and had to purchase the items that are furnishing the house. Those costs will be recouped by a higher monthly rent. It is up to you as the landlord to decide how much more you need to bill for the furnishings, but generally the increased cost will be based by owners on the state and style of the furnishings. For example, a property that includes a brand-new, modern living room set is worth more than one that includes mismatched pieces with frayed seams.
In addition to or instead of a higher rent for a furnished apartment, you could ask for a higher security deposit on the rental. Collecting more money up front can assist you to cover the costs of repairing or replacing the items in the furnished flat if they're damaged. Check with your state laws before collecting the security deposit, though. Some states have laws regulating security deposits and what landlords can charge. If you do not want to contain it in the security deposit, you could also charge another cleaning fee for the rental, to pay for the costs of cleaning curtains, bedding, furniture and other things.

Any service that incurs a fee should be comprised in the lease, including phone usage, garbage, laundry, housekeeping, and parking. Sometimes, discretionary services are accessible, like daily housekeeping services in addition to cleaning upon departure. These should be, at a minimum, listed on the lease in case the vacationers choose to use the service after they arrive. Expectations about the utilization of the property should also be clearly indicated--either in the lease or via a procedures manual referenced in the contract. Who cleans the grill? Who takes the garbage out and where does it go? Should the sheets be stripped housekeeping or by by the vacationers? Must the dishes be washed before housekeeping arrives? These are all issues that should be addressed to ensure a smooth holiday and prevent conflicts over the stay and the lease.

The dates and times of departure and arrival are spelled out in great specificity in the vacation rental lease. Vacationers are coming and going every week--sometimes every few days--and the units must be cleaned in between stays. To avert vacancy between stays, the time between check-in and checkout is normally a comparatively short window. And because some vacationers rely on air transportation, there are sometimes last minute requests to arrive or depart early or late. It's, therefore, crucial that you include contingency requests in the lease, signifying both a procedure and a price to change agreed upon plans.
